Supported UI capabilities
DX API supports a growing number of UI components. Depending on your version of Pega Platform, the support may vary.
The limited
actions include Refresh, Run Script, Set Value,Take Action,
and Local Action.Capability Introduced in Displays built with Case Designer 8.1 Sections that utilize dynamic layouts, table layouts,
repeating dynamic layouts, and embedded sections 8.1 Harnesses that utilize screen layouts 8.1 When expressions and rules that are run on the server 8.1 High level (limited) actions/event data. 8.1 Auto-generated controls, such as pxTextInput
and pxRadio
8.1 Guardrail-compliant sections and harnesses (except
Perform) 8.1 Localized labels, titles, captions, and buttons 8.1 Standard modes for read-only and editable fields 8.1 Fields, labels, and paragraph 8.1 Fields in a section that can be validated based on access
privileges 8.1 Property references to elements (sections and titles) and
conditions (visibility, disable, and read-only) 8.3 Titles in headers of sections and layouts 8.3 Inline data page or clipboard data for drop-down lists, radio
buttons, and auto-complete fields 8.3 The default newRow
API object for page
groups and page lists8.3 The pageInstructions
API object for page
lists, page groups, and pages8.3 Format for layout, container, and control 8.3 The pyDXAPIEncodeValues
application setting 8.3
